VMware vSphere is everywhere.

Nonvirtualized data centers are a thing of the past; in order to stay relevant-and scale infrastructure to meet business needs-you must understand vSphere. vSphere 6.7 Foundations is an eight-part series designed for anyone who wants to learn vSphere, including absolute beginners, and develop the knowledge to pass the VMware vSphere 6.7 Foundations exam (2V0-01.19). In this course, instructor Rick Crisci explains how to administer availability in vSphere and vCenter. Learn how to use heartbeats, configure high availability, set up file backup in vCSA, and configure a fault tolerant environment.
